Additional Information
- This product is an inclinometer (sensor), not a robot arm. The schema field 'category' is set to 'industrial-arm' as the closest available option, but this is a sensor component often used in robotic and industrial applications. - Key technical specs: 2 Axes, Analog current 4-20 mA interface, Static/Accelerometer technology. - Measurement range: ±30°, accuracy (INL): ±0.10°, resolution: 0.01°. - High ingress protection: IP68/IP69K, suitable for harsh environments. - Operating temperature range: -40°C to +85°C. - MTTF: 400 years @ 40°C. - Housing material: Stainless Steel V4A (1.4404, 316 L). - Weight: 275 g. - Connection: M12, 8-pin, a-coded connector. - CE certified. - Includes teach-in preset function. - Product life cycle: New. - Accessories available: cables (2m, 5m, 10m PUR) and analog displays (AP22-D0, DiMod-A).
